I just reinstalled seadas 7.3.2 manually on ubuntu 14 and have the ocssw processors running fine from the command line.  i just went to run l2gen from the GUI and realised none of the processors are available.  did I miss something in the install to point the GUI to the ocssw processors?

The default location of ocssw for the GUI is <seadas_install_dir>/ocssw while for the command-line installer it is $HOME/ocssw.   You can change the location in the GUI by editing <seadas_install_dir/config/seadas.config.   For example, to use $HOME/ocssw the last few lines of seadas.config would be something like:
# set location of OCSSWROOT
seadas.ocssw.root = /home/<seadas_user>/ocssw
seadas.ocssw.location = local
